(K0.48(2)Na0.52(2))2Al2B2O7 (K0.96Na1.04Al2B2O7) Crystal Structure
General Information
- Phase Label(s): K0.96Na1.04Al2B2O7
- Structure Class(es): –
- Classification by Properties: –
- Mineral Name(s): –
- Pearson Symbol: hP63
- Space Group: 150
- Phase Prototype: (K0.5Na0.5)2Al2[BO3]2O
- Measurement Detail(s): automatic diffractometer (determination of cell parameters), automatic diffractometer; STOE IPDS II (determination of structural parameters), X-rays, Mo Kα (determination of cell and structural parameters), T = 293 K (determination of cell and structural parameters)
- Phase Class(es): –
- Compound Class(es): borate
- Interpretation Detail(s): complete structure determined, full-matrix least-squares refinement on F2; 73 variables; 1056 reflections; I > 2σ(I), R = 0.0304; wR = 0.0713
- Sample Detail(s): sample prepared from (K0.5Na0.5)2Al2B2O7, single crystal (determination of cell parameters), single crystal, 0.120×0.140×0.180 mm3 (determination of structural parameters)
Substance Summary
- Standard Formula: K0.96Na1.04Al2[BO3]2O
- Alphabetic Formula: Al2[BO3]2K0.96Na1.04O
- Published Formula: (K0.48(2)Na0.52(2))2Al2B2O7
- Refined Formula: Al2B2K0.96Na1.04O6.99
- Wyckoff Sequence: 150,g8fe2d2c
- Z Formula Units: 3
- Density: ρ = 2.52 Mg·m−3
